Written Answers. - Beaumount (Dublin) Hospital.

Brendan Howlin

Ceist:

96 Mr. Howlin asked the Minister for Health if he has satisfied himself that he continues to receive accurate information from the board of Beaumont Hospital regarding recent controversies in neurosurgery; that the Church and General Insurance Company will continue to provide insurance cover at the hospital; and if he will make a statement on the matter.

I have had no reason to doubt the accuracy of any information which I or my Department received from the board or their officers of Beaumont Hospital concerning the hospital's neuro-surgical services. If the Deputy has evidence to the contrary, he should, of course, ensure that the information is made available.

The question of insurance cover is a matter for the hospital. I understand that there has been no change in the arrangements provided by the insurance company mentioned by the Deputy.
